Florida College Democrats Rock the J.J.
The Florida College Democrats had a great successful trip to the Florida Democratic Party's Annual Jefferson Jackson Dinner. We had members from six different chapters around the state and made presentations to many of the FDP's well-established caucuses. As we made an attempt to reintroduce ourselves to the party, we garnered much support from many party members as we should all be encouraged by our growing place within the party.

Results of the FCD Elections
Congratulations to our newly elected Exec Board for the 2008-2009 School Year
Here are the elections results
Votes came in from Stetson, FIU, FAU, UF, USF, and UCF.
Results as follows:
President: 15 for John Martino, 3 abstentions.
Vice President of North Florida: 15 for Danielle Emenhiser, 3 abstentions
Vice President of Central Florida: 11 for Matthew Coppens, 7 for Miki Hirama, 0 abstentions
Vice President of South Florida: 15 for Kevin Tipton Cho, 3 abstentions
Financial Director: 15 for Joe Martino, 3 absentations
Secretary: 15 for Ben Cavataro, 3 abstentions
Public Relations Director: 14 for Amanda Campau, 4 for Jay Shannon, 0 abstentions
The FCD would like to thank all who voted in this election and all who ran. Your work is appreciated and this organization could not survive unless individuals like yourselves are will to step up to the plate. The e-board will be in transition this week.

Fairness For All Families
In October 2007, the Florida College Democrats officially endorsed the
Fairness for All Families Campaign
During a campus event for Pride Awareness Month, University of Florida College Democrats asked their peers to pledge to vote NO to the "Marriage Protection" Amendment by signing the poster picture below.
